Hedge fund analyst appointed at Gartmore

clock

Gartmore has expanded its European equities team and taken on Pierre Castela as hedge fund analyst on its AlphaGen Capella and AlphaGen Velas funds.

Castela will join Gartmore in April reporting to and supporting Roger Guy and Guillaume Rambourg on the US$1.6bn large-cap European long/short equity fund - AlphaGen Capella – as well as supporting David Thompson on the recently launched European equity long/short directional fund – known as the AlphaGen Velas.
